KDE Kickoff Menu Mouse click problems

Hello guys -

I have noticed an weird effect in KDE 4.2.2 when I click the KDE menu Kickoff open and then click on some other window it doesnt minimizes itslef auttomatically but I have to go to the Kickoff menu opne button on the taskbar to minimize it any suggestions to this problem ?

Another quick one; when you are a non root user and try to access your other ard drive partitions you get thsi freedesktop hal permissions denied error; any quick solution to that problem. I have already added the user to group storage and optical!

Furthermore in Kubuntu when I used to open the Kickoff menu the mouse cursor used to - straight go to the search box; while for KDE 4.2.2 in Arch it doesn't which is quiet annoying.

Re: KDE Kickoff Menu Mouse click problems

That bugreport is only about opening kickoff with hotkeys - different issue. And yes, the mentioned method (last post) works, but not being able to make kickoff disappear with a click on the desktop remains. And btw, this is not only a kickoff problem - it happens with other applets too. And it does not happen with other Window Managers, so its either a plasma or kwin bug. or both smile
